  • Notes
  • Drehbare Ferritantenne, Wunschklang-Register, Gegentakt-Endstufe.

    Bei UKW wird die HF-Vorstufe in Reflexschaltung auch als erste FM-ZF-Stufe verwendet, das ergibt insgesamt 3 FM-ZF-Stufen.
    Rückwandangabe 8 AM- und 13 FM-Kreise ist (werbewirksam) falsch.

Gentlemen,

I am restoring a Grundig 5088 USA model and need some help with my first non-US radio restoration.  I am using a schematic found at www.rad-io.de  I have found it to be mostly accurate except for some of the audio frequency circuit architecture.  There are differences.

A friend of the family has translated most of the words.  So my questions are with the missing information below:

The resistors have the resitance printed on the body and a single color band on one end.  What does this band represent and what are the values of the colors?




I have identified three types of fixed capacitors; Paper (Papier), Syrofome (Styrofier?) and Ceramic/mica (Keromic?).  However, there are some paper capacitors that have a plastic like blue coating.  The schematic clearly identifies these as paper.  Is there more to these capacitors? Are they special (i.e., inverse temperature, resonant) capacitors?



Once I have replaced all of the paper and electrolytic capacitors (and the occational off tolerance resistor) RF alignment is next.   The IF frequencies (10.7/460) and the transformers are identified. However, there are plenty of other adjustments with no explanation.  Where might I find the alignment procedures? 

Please forgive me if this information is readily available on the internet.  If so, then please recomend an appropriate web site.
